WebThe most noticeable sign that a hard-cooked egg has gone bad is the odor. If the egg has any sort of unpleasant, sulfurous, or rotten smell, it has gone bad and should not be consumed. If the hard-boiled egg is still in its shell, you may have to crack it open in order to notice any odor.

WebMar 12, 2024 · How Long Do Hard Boiled Eggs Last. According to FoodSafety.gov, you can store hard-boiled eggs for about a week. And if you already googled that topic, you know pretty much everyone agrees with this exact time frame. One thing to note is that the period is for unpeeled eggs, and peeled eggs don’t retain good quality for as long of a period. WebOct 13, 2024 · What happens if I eat a bad hard-boiled egg? The main risk of eating bad eggs is Salmonella infection, which can cause diarrhea, vomiting, and fever. A person can reduce the risk of Salmonella by keeping eggs refrigerated, discarding any with cracked shells, and cooking them thoroughly before eating them.
